Rip Off by Indian Railways - 2nd Class A.C passengers cheated

Wife travelled by Indian Railways from Chennai to Bombay via 12164 Chennai Express on 5th July 2014 which arrived into Bombay on 6th July 2014. She was travelling on a 2 tier A.C. ticket. Right from the outset at Chennai itself there was a rip off by Indian Railways as the 2 tier A.C. compartment had only 20 seats against the normal 64 seats in any compartment. With the result that the 2 tier A.C. passengers were forced to sit in 3 tier A.C. seats. The compartment was a combination of 2 tier A.C. and 3 tier A.C. seats.

The TTE (travelling ticket examiner) did not bother to offer any explanation nor any apology for this fracas and they were told by the regular maintenance staff of the Indian railways that this is a regular practice by the Indian Railways wherein the 2 tier class A.C. passengers are forced to sit in the 3 tier A.C. On top of it the TTE also forced the passengers to pay the difference in fares owing to the recent hike in fares by the Indian Railways. Therefore the passengers were paying the normal 2 tier A.C. ticket fare and they were forced to travel in 3 tier A.C. berths.

There was no prior intimation via SMS or any other means by the IRCTC wherein the passengers should have been informed by the Indian railways of the change in their status.

If this is a regular practice going on, then surely it is a scam in the making or a full fledged scam with the connivance of the higher authorities.

People book 2 tier A.C. berths due to the relatively better comfort it provides in terms of the extra space available in the compartment, less no. of passengers using the toilets, the privacy provided by the curtains etc. When people travel for long duration such as this train which takes 24 hours to reach from Chennai to Bombay, they obviously would want to travel in better comfort for which they are paying a premium amount on the 2 tier A.C. berths.

The passengers who suffered thus should be refunded the difference in fares and compensated for the mental tension and trauma that was created due to this fracas by Indian Railways.
